Job Summary: The Senior Project Manager is responsible for planning and managing internal/external customer facing project(s) by balancing scope, cost, time and quality to delivery customer requirements and satisfaction. Senior Project Managers may be responsible for managing and creating project budgets for their projects. Project complexity and team size will vary from large to very large. The Project Manager monitors projects daily to track progress against the schedule, resolve risks/issues and manage project changes. The Senior Project Manager will have exceptional skills in the following: communication, presentation, time management, problem solving, team player, and customer. This position works collaboratively with other Healthways departments to ensure the project is aligned with business needs, and acts as a central information source for each project.
